Magnitude 5.5 Earthquake Strikes Near Jurm in Afghanistan’s Hindu Kush Region

Theindiapostdaily.com – On July 1, a magnitude 5.5 earthquake strikes near Jurm, Afghanistan, triggering tremors in the Hindu Kush mountain range. The United States Geological Survey (USGS) recorded the event at 17:57:03 UTC, with the epicenter located approximately 50 kilometers southwest of Jurm in northeastern Afghanistan. The quake, classified as a deep-focus event due to its depth of 216.7 km, underscores the region’s seismic susceptibility and its role in generating powerful tremors that ripple across neighboring countries.

Deep-Focus Quake: What It Means for Impact and Perception

Deep-focus earthquakes, which originate several hundred kilometers beneath the Earth’s surface, are often less destructive in terms of surface damage than shallower ones. However, their effects can be felt over vast distances, making them significant for regions like the Hindu Kush, where tectonic activity is frequent. The USGS noted that while the magnitude 5.5 earthquake strikes near Jurm did not cause immediate casualties or structural damage, it was strong enough to generate vibrations detectable in nearby areas. Such events highlight the need for regional preparedness, even in regions where deep quakes are common.

“Deep earthquakes, though less likely to cause localized destruction, can still have widespread effects due to their depth and the tectonic forces at play,” explained Dr. Aisha Khan, a seismologist with the Pakistan Meteorological Department (PMD). “This particular event is a reminder of the ongoing geological activity in the region.”

Regional Seismic History and Patterns

Afghanistan’s location at the convergent boundary of the Indian and Eurasian tectonic plates has made it a hotspot for seismic activity. The Hindu Kush region, in particular, has a history of producing both shallow and deep earthquakes, often linked to the subduction of the Indian plate beneath the Eurasian plate. The magnitude 5.5 earthquake strikes near Jurm occurred in a zone that has seen similar quakes in recent months, including a magnitude 5.2 event on June 22, which struck about 42 kilometers south-southwest of Jurm in Badakhshan province. These recurring tremors suggest that the region remains tectonically active.

“The proximity of these events to Jurm indicates that the area is part of a larger seismic network,” said PMD spokesperson Farhan Raza. “While deep quakes are less damaging, they are still a critical part of the region’s seismic behavior.”

The recent magnitude 5.5 earthquake strikes near Jurm follow a pattern of seismic activity that has persisted for decades. Historical records show that the Hindu Kush has been the epicenter of major earthquakes, such as the 2005 Kashmir earthquake, which reached a magnitude of 7.6 and caused widespread devastation. Despite the lack of immediate damage from the July 1 quake, the region’s vulnerability to stronger tremors remains a concern for scientists and local communities alike.
